| | | Hi there Hi there, just to say hello been a member for a short while now find the site very interesting.
My main interest in the field of natural history is British mammals, in particular Badger, Fox, Otter and Deer.
I'm very much into wildlife photography both still and video now although was a 16mm man.
Very much a Canon man using a XL2 and D5 with 300mm f2.8 and 100-400mm plus a variety of other lens including macro's.
Presently involved in filming a pair of foxes plus a project on Blue Tits with several mini camera's situated in nest boxes transmitting back to a base station and recording equipment.
Have also fitted remote camera to the entrance to the Fox earth although at the moment not much of interest happening yet - there are cubs in the earth but its early days.
